AI Cracks the Raphael Code 🎨

Using AI, researchers uncovered a surprising twist in Raphael's "Madonna della Rosa." The AI's deep analysis suggested that St Joseph's face was painted by another artist, possibly Raphael's pupil.

Chip Innovation: The Next Frontier

The US government's ambitious CHIPS and Science Act signals a moonshot for computing, much like the Apollo missions. With a $50 billion investment, it aims to revitalize the microelectronics industry and maintain global competitiveness.
